La gouvernance des données, dans le contexte de la modélisation des données, fait référence à la gestion formelle des données au sein d'une organisation, englobant les processus, politiques, structures organisationnelles et technologies mis en place pour garantir la disponibilité, l'accessibilité, l'intégrité, la qualité et la sécurité des données. . Il s’agit d’un aspect crucial pour garantir que les données sont utilisées de manière efficace et cohérente au sein d’une organisation, tout en respectant les exigences réglementaires et en atténuant les risques. L'objectif principal de la gouvernance des données est de permettre aux organisations de prendre des décisions basées sur les données, à la fois éclairées et conformes, en minimisant les écarts et les incohérences dans les données.
Dans le développement de logiciels modernes, la gouvernance des données revêt une importance primordiale en raison des quantités toujours croissantes de données générées, collectées, stockées et analysées dans les entreprises. En conséquence, les organisations doivent disposer de stratégies et de structures de gouvernance des données bien définies pour garantir que les données restent exactes, cohérentes et sécurisées tout au long de leur cycle de vie.
Dans le cadre de la modélisation des données, la gouvernance des données implique plusieurs éléments clés, notamment :
Qualité des données : englobe l'exactitude, la cohérence, l'exhaustivité et l'actualité des données. Une gouvernance efficace des données garantit que les données sont exactes et conformes à un ensemble de normes prédéfinies, ce qui les rend adaptées à l'analyse et à la prise de décision.
Gestion des données : implique l'attribution des responsabilités et la propriété des données. Les gestionnaires de données sont responsables du maintien de la qualité des données et de la garantie que les données sont utilisées correctement et de manière éthique dans toute l’organisation.
Sécurité des données : garantit que les données sont protégées contre tout accès non autorisé, corruption ou fuite. La gouvernance des données comprend la mise en œuvre de contrôles d'accès appropriés, de mécanismes de cryptage et d'outils de surveillance pour protéger les informations sensibles.
Confidentialité des données : met en évidence la protection des informations personnelles identifiables (PII) et le respect des lois et réglementations sur la confidentialité (par exemple, RGPD, HIPAA). La gouvernance des données définit et applique des politiques concernant la collecte, le stockage et l'utilisation des informations personnelles dans l'ensemble de l'organisation.
Lignage des données : implique la traçabilité des données depuis leur origine jusqu'à leur consommation éventuelle, illustrant la façon dont les données changent et se déplacent dans l'organisation. La gouvernance des données intègre le lignage des données pour fournir une visibilité sur les transformations des données, les dépendances et les hypothèses formulées lors du traitement des données.
Catalogage de données : implique la création et la maintenance d’un inventaire complet des actifs de données d’une organisation. Un catalogue de données centralise les métadonnées pour une découverte rapide et efficace des données, ce qui facilite la gouvernance des données en donnant aux utilisateurs une compréhension claire des données avec lesquelles ils travaillent.
AppMaster, une plateforme no-code pour la création d'applications backend, Web et mobiles, reconnaît l'importance de la gouvernance des données dans le développement de logiciels. Il permet aux clients de créer visuellement des modèles de données (schéma de base de données), garantissant l'intégrité et la cohérence des données entre les applications. Les clients peuvent également concevoir une logique métier et endpoints d'API à l'aide du concepteur visuel BP (Business Process) Designer, en maintenant ainsi des pratiques appropriées de gestion des données tout au long du processus de développement de l'application.
En offrant un environnement de développement intégré (IDE), AppMaster rationalise le processus de création d'applications Web, mobiles et backend avec la gouvernance des données en son cœur. Grâce à l'approche d' AppMaster consistant à régénérer les applications à partir de zéro chaque fois que les exigences sont modifiées, la dette technique est éliminée, garantissant ainsi que les modèles de données restent à jour et entièrement conformes aux politiques de gouvernance.
Les puissantes fonctionnalités no-code d' AppMaster offrent aux organisations un moyen transparent et efficace de gérer leurs besoins en matière de gouvernance des données. Avec la capacité de créer visuellement des modèles de données et une logique métier, de maintenir un catalogue de données précis et fiable et de garantir la confidentialité et la sécurité des données, AppMaster propose une solution complète de gouvernance des données qui permet aux entreprises de développer des applications évolutives et conformes rapidement et efficacement.